Curve 4606i1

4606 = 2 · 72 · 47



Data for elliptic curve 4606i1

Field Data Notes
Atkin-Lehner 2- 7- 47+ Signs for the Atkin-Lehner involutions
Class 4606i Isogeny class
Conductor 4606 Conductor
∏ cp 24 Product of Tamagawa factors cp
deg 4608 Modular degree for the optimal curve
Δ -158541910016 = -1 · 212 · 77 · 47 Discriminant
Eigenvalues 2-  1  1 7- -5 -2  6 -4 Hecke eigenvalues for primes up to 20
Equation [1,0,0,1175,11353] [a1,a2,a3,a4,a6]
Generators [18:187:1] Generators of the group modulo torsion
j 1524845951/1347584 j-invariant
L 6.2737314121994 L(r)(E,1)/r!
Ω 0.66675638371803 Real period
R 0.39205545217375 Regulator
r 1 Rank of the group of rational points
S 1 (Analytic) order of Ш
t 1 Number of elements in the torsion subgroup
Twists 36848t1 41454y1 115150p1 658d1 Quadratic twists by: -4 -3 5 -7
